Best Port Angeles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 4 public middle schools serving 702 students in Port Angeles, WA.
The top-ranked public middle schools in Port Angeles, WA are Stevens Middle School and Seaview Academy.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Port Angeles, WA public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 41% (versus the Washington public middle school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 52% (versus the 51% statewide average). Middle schools in Port Angeles have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Washington public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 29%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Washington public middle school average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
